Imagine a smooth-flowing river. Clear waters with no obstacles slowing them down. This calm river is like the blood flowing through your arteries.
Now, imagine sediments and gunk slowly accumulating in this river, disrupting its flow. This is precisely what unhealthy cholesterol does to your arteries.
Over time, these 'sediments' or plaques can build up, obstructing the arteries, making the heart work harder to move blood, and preparing the way for heart diseases like arrhythmias, atherosclerosis, stroke, etc.
